moocow007 wrote:One guy that really has taken off and yet flown under the cover is this man.

Image

As demonstrative and braggadocious as he is, he has managed to back it all up. I still remember listening to a pre-draft interview that I believe Givony was giving where it Givony basically brought up different plays where Edwards did something wrong and Edwards was shooting exactly what he did wrong and what he should have done without even thinking. That's when I knew this guy was going to be able to make it big.

And he's doing it all without holding the ball to death. For a guy who's the clear cut no.1 option on his team he's not up there in time of possession. He's even further down on the list in terms of seconds per touch. If you want someone that can potentially pair real well with a PG that is ball dominant (and I believe Brunson is tops in the NBA in time of possession and all that while also being a bonafide top tier elite option on offense, a guy like Edwards is it. Too bad...


Here's that video I was talking about for anyone interested. It wasn't with Givony. It was with Mike Schmitz. These are the things I'm interested in when it comes to prospects. They do this often but because it's not highlights they don't get a lot of play.



Oh and apparently he's not lazy and disinterested after all as quite a lot of you yokels said he was. :lol: Honestly he's gotten even faster in the NBA and significantly improved his ball handling even as he added on more weight and muscle. That's not something that you see often and says a lot about his frame of mind when it comes to being a great player.
